15-da0053wm laptop
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

On 1/12/2021 I successfully installed 2021-01 Cumulative Update for Windows 10 Version 20H2 for x64 Based Systems (KB4598242). Today Windows Update tried to install it again on one machine, while the other machine says it is up to date. This re-installation failed with error code 0x007000d.

 

It is doing the same thing with an optional update on both machines, a Driver update Hewlett-Packard Development Company, L.P.- Keyboard- Standard 101/102-Key or Microsoft Natural PS/2 Keyboard for HP Hotkey Support. This successfully installed on both machines on both1/4/2021 and 1/11/2021, but Windows Update wants to install it yet again. 

How can I stop Windows from attempting to re-install something it already installed?

Hi:

 

You should be able to run the Hide Windows Update utility from the link below and hide the updates.
